Concrete Ramp Installation in Fort Collins, CO
Concrete ramp installation services provide a durable and accessible solution for creating smooth, level pathways on residential properties. These ramps are commonly used to improve accessibility for wheelchairs, scooters, or strollers, and can also serve as convenient transitions between different levels of a yard or driveway. Projects may include installing ramps at entryways, garages, patios, or garden areas, helping property owners enhance safety and convenience around their homes.
Before requesting concrete ramp installation, property owners often want to understand the scope of the project, including the size, slope, and location of the ramp, as well as any specific accessibility requirements. It's also helpful to consider the surrounding landscape and existing structures to ensure the new ramp integrates seamlessly with the property. Proper planning can help ensure the finished installation meets both functional needs and aesthetic preferences.

Concrete Ramp Installation Questions
What types of projects typically require concrete ramp installation? Concrete ramps are commonly used for wheelchair access, garage entryways, and building entrances to improve accessibility and safety.
How long does a concrete ramp installation usually take? The installation duration depends on the project's size and complexity, but it generally involves several days for proper curing and finishing.
What should property owners consider before installing a concrete ramp? Factors include the location, slope requirements, load capacity, and integration with existing surfaces for safety and functionality.
Are there different styles or finishes available for concrete ramps? Yes, options include textured surfaces for slip resistance and various finishes to match the property's aesthetic preferences.
